1.
Overview
2.
Quick Start
2.1.
ShardingSphere-JDBC
2.2.
ShardingSphere-Proxy
2.3.
ShardingSphere-Scaling(Alpha)
3.
Concepts & Features
3.1.
Sharding
3.1.1.
Core Concept
SQL
Sharding
Configuration
Inline Expression
Distributed Primary Key
Hint Sharding Route
3.1.2.
Guide to Kernel
Parse Engine
Route Engine
Rewrite Engine
Execute Engine
Merger Engine
3.1.3.
Use Norms
SQL
Pagination
3.2.
Distributed Transaction
3.2.1.
Core Concept
XA Transaction
Seata BASE transaction
3.2.2.
Principle
XA Transaction
Seata BASE transaction
3.2.3.
Use Norms
Local Transaction
XA transaction
Seata BASE transaction
3.3.
Replica query
3.3.1.
Core Concept
3.3.2.
Use Norms
3.4.
Governance
3.4.1
Management
Registry Center
Third-party Components
Change History
3.4.2
Observability
APM Integration
Agent Integration
3.5.
Scaling
3.5.1.
Core Concept
3.5.2.
Principle
3.5.3.
User Norms
3.6.
Encryption
3.6.1.
Core Concept
3.6.2.
Principle
3.6.3.
Use Norms
3.7.
Shadow DB
3.7.1.
Core Concept
3.7.2.
Principle
3.8.
Dist SQL
3.8.1.
Syntax
3.8.1.1
RDL Syntax
Data Source
Sharding
Readwrite-Splitting
Encrypt
DB Discovery
3.8.1.2
RQL Syntax
Data Source
Sharding
Readwrite-Splitting
Encrypt
DB Discovery
3.8.1.3
SCTL Syntax
SCTL
3.8.2
Usage
Sharding
3.9.
Pluggable Architecture
3.10.
Test Engine
3.9.1.
Integration Test
3.9.2.
SQL Parser Test
3.9.3.
SQL Rewrite Test
3.9.4.
Performance Test
3.9.5.
Performance Test(sysbench)
4.
User Manual
4.1.
ShardingSphere-JDBC
4.1.1.
Usage
Data Sharding
Use Java API
Use YAML
Use Spring Boot Starter
Use Spring Namespace
Hint
Transaction
Use Java API
Use Spring Boot Starter
Use Spring Namespace
Atomikos Transaction
Bitronix Transaction
Narayana Transaction
Seata Transaction
Governance
Use Java API
Use YAML
Use Spring Boot Starter
Use Spring Namespace
4.1.2.
Configuration Manual
Java API
Sharding
Readwrite-splitting
Encryption
Shadow DB
Governance
Mixed Rules
Change History
YAML Configuration
Sharding
Readwrite-splitting
Encryption
Shadow DB
Governance
Mixed Rules
Change History
Spring Boot Starter Configuration
Sharding
Readwrite splitting
Encryption
Shadow DB
Governance
Mixed Rules
Change History
Spring Namespace Configuration
Sharding
Readwrite-splitting
Encryption
Shadow DB
Governance
Mixed Rules
Change History
Built-in Algorithm
Sharding Algorithm
Key Generate Algorithm
Load Balance Algorithm
Encryption Algorithm
Properties Configuration
4.1.3.
Unsupported Items
4.2.
ShardingSphere-Proxy
4.2.1.
Usage
Proxy Startup
Governance
Distributed Transaction
4.2.2.
Configuration Manual
Data Source Configuration
Authentication
Properties Configuration
YAML Syntax
4.2.3.
Docker Clone
4.3.
ShardingSphere-Sidecar
4.4.
ShardingSphere-Scaling
4.4.1.
Build
4.4.2.
Manual
4.5.
ShardingSphere-UI
4.5.1.
Manual
Build
Registry Center
Rule Config
Runtime Status
5.
Dev Manual
5.1.
SQL Parser
5.2.
Configuration
5.3.
Kernel
5.4.
Data Sharding
5.5.
Readwrite-splitting
5.6.
Data Encryption
5.7.
SQL Audit
5.8.
Distributed Transaction
5.9.
Distributed Governance
5.10.
Scaling
5.11.
Proxy
6.
Downloads
7.
FAQ
English
简体中文
Download PDF
ShardingSphere
>
Concepts & Features
>
Dist SQL
>
Syntax
>
RDL Syntax
> Data Source
Data Source
TODO
TODO